Why Fog Liquids Matter More for Outdoor Stage Events
Outdoor stage environments are vastly different from controlled indoor spaces. Wind currents, humidity, temperature fluctuations, and expansive open areas can make or break the impact of your fog effect.
Key Challenges:
Wind Dispersal: Standard indoor fog liquids often dissipate within seconds outdoors.
Lighting Compatibility: Open-air lighting setups require fog with the right density to highlight beams effectively.
Audience Safety: High-capacity events demand fog liquids that are non-toxic and low in residue.
Data Insight:
Studies show that low-density fog fluids dissipate within 30–60 seconds in open air under light wind (5–10 mph).
High-density outdoor fog liquids can persist for 3–5 minutes, depending on wind protection and placement.

Key Features to Look for in Outdoor Fog Machine Liquids
1. High-Density Formula
Liquids designed for outdoor use typically have higher concentrations of glycols and larger particle sizes to ensure longer hang times.
2. Fast Dispersion vs. Long Hang Time
Fast dispersion fluids are ideal for dynamic scenes or rapid-fire effects.
Long-hang fog liquids are better for ambient coverage and lighting enhancement.
3. Low Residue
Outdoor fog should not leave sticky residues on lighting rigs or stage equipment.
4. Safe for Audience and Environment
Look for liquids with FDA-approved ingredients and compliant with CE, RoHS, or MSDS standards.
5. Lighting Compatibility
Choose liquids with particle properties that scatter light beams effectively under LED, strobe, and laser illumination.
6. Temperature Adaptability
Fog performance changes with temperature. High-quality liquids are engineered to work consistently across 10°C to 40°C.

Comparing Fog Liquid Types for Outdoor Use
Type | Composition | Hang Time | Residue | Outdoor Use |
---|---|---|---|---|
Water-Based | Water + glycol | Short–medium | Low | Moderate |
Glycol-Based | More glycols | Long | Medium | High |
Glycerin-Based | Glycerin-heavy | Longest | Sticky | Not recommended for outdoor |
Hybrid Blends | Balanced | Customizable | Low | Excellent |

Safety Tips for Using Fog Liquids Outdoors
Position machines away from crowd airflow
Monitor wind direction before activating fog
Only use certified fog fluids
Store liquids at room temperature and away from sunlight
Don’t mix brands or modify liquids
Run machines in test mode before full event use
How to Maximize Fog Effect in Outdoor Conditions
Use fog during dusk or low wind times
Utilize fog machines with fan controls
Set fog to sync with music and lighting
Use DMX-controlled intervals to conserve fluid
Shield fog area with temporary stage barriers to trap effect
